Seat Time:

When it comes to racing, there’s no substitute for seat time. Practice sessions, qualifying rounds, and racing events all provide valuable seat time for drivers looking to improve their skills and performance on the track. But what exactly is and why is it so important?

  • What is Seat Time?
  • Seat time refers to the amount of time that a driver spends behind the wheel of their race car, practicing, qualifying, or competing in races. It’s a crucial factor in a driver’s development, as it allows them to become more familiar with their vehicle and the track they’re racing on. As drivers become more experienced and gain more they are better equipped to handle different situations on the track, anticipate unexpected events, and make quick decisions when needed.

  • Why is Seat Time Important?
  • Seat time is critical for a driver’s success in racing. It helps them develop their skills and hone their instincts, allowing them to react quickly and safely in various racing scenarios. As they become more accustomed to their car’s performance, they can push their limits and improve lap times. Additionally, seat time provides an opportunity for drivers to build relationships with their pit crew and other industry professionals, gaining valuable insights and feedback that can help them improve their performance even further.

Whether you’re a seasoned driver or just starting out in the world of racing, seat time will always be a crucial element in your journey to success. Over time, every moment spent behind the wheel adds up to give drivers the competitive edge they need to win races, set records, and achieve their goals in the racing industry. opioids

are a class of drugs that are commonly used for pain relief. They work by binding to specific receptors in the brain and spinal cord, reducing pain signals sent to the brain. While can be effective in managing pain, they also carry a high risk of dependence and addiction.

According to the Centers for Disease Control and Prevention (CDC), more than 70,000 people died from drug overdoses in the United States in 2019, with being a major contributor to these deaths. Along with the risk of addiction, other potential side effects of include respiratory depression, nausea, constipation, and drowsiness.

Ways to reduce the risk of opioid dependence and addiction:

  • Use only as prescribed by a healthcare provider
  • Do not mix with other drugs or alcohol
  • Dispose of unused properly
  • Never share with others
  • Consider alternative pain management options

Alternative pain management options:

  • Physical therapy
  • Acupuncture
  • Cognitive-behavioral therapy
  • Non-opioid pain medication

If you or someone you know is struggling with opioid addiction, it’s important to seek help from a healthcare professional. Treatment options may include medication-assisted therapy, counseling, or support groups.
